Carpal Tunnel Syndrome The median nerve enters the hand through the tunnel on your wrist. As the tunnel gets narrowed, the nerve gets compressed, leading to a numbness of the index finger as well as the thumb and middle finger. Usually, this finger numbness gets worse at night.

Web16. okt 2024. · Raynaud's phenomenon, often just called Raynaud's, is a condition where the small blood vessels of the fingers become narrow (constrict), most commonly when they are in a cool environment. Sometimes blood vessels to other extremities such as the toes, ears and nose are affected.
